Alleged smuggler taken down NFL style after going toe-to-toe with border agent in WILD video

Video of a confrontation between two illegal immigrants who are identified as suspected smugglers and Border Patrol agents is drawing buzz on social media for one agent’s takedown of an aggressive illegal using a flying tackle straight out of the National Football League.

The video clip, which was shared by Rep. Mayra Flores (R-Texas), begins with a San Diego Sector Border Patrol agent standing over a man on the ground who is covered with sand and has been subdued before panning to another migrant smuggling suspect who is squaring off with a baton-wielding agent.

The migrant acts in an aggressive manner as the crowd cheers him on, turning and advancing on a second Border Patrol agent who is backing away.

Then the video shows a third agent who runs toward the unfolding situation and launches himself at the suspected smuggler, bringing him to the ground with a flying tackle that conjured visions of NFL all-pro defensive lineman J.J. Watt in his prime.

The three CBP agents then all team up to take the migrant into custody as the crowd’s cheers turn to chants of a vulgar term in Spanish from those who were watching the action from the Mexican side of the border.

According to the U.S. Customs and Border Protection website:

“The San Diego Sector encompasses 56,831 square miles including 931 miles of coastal border from the California border with Mexico north to Oregon. San Diego Sector’s primary operational area of responsibility consists of 7,000 square miles including 60 linear miles of international boundary with Mexico and 114 coastal border miles along the Pacific Ocean.” ”

“The San Diego Sector encompasses coastal beaches and expansive mesas that lead to coastal and inland mountains, rugged canyons, and high desert. Directly south of San Diego lie the Mexican cities of Tijuana and Tecate, Baja California, which have a combined population of more than four and a half million people.”
